A 61-year-old Johnson City man said he wasn’t injured Wednesday when a toilet exploded with water and launched him against a wall. Richard Szymanski said he was using his son’s toilet at 69 Carlton St., Johnson City, when steam started coming out the toilet after he flushed. Before he could stand up the toilet shot out hot water and he was thrown a few feet into a shower wall. “It was kind of hot there for a minute,” said Szymanski. Szymanski said he was a little dizzy, but he didn’t think he was seriously injured. That’ was fortunate, considering he has stitches on his head from the removal of a cancerous tumor on Tuesday, he said. The Johnson City Fire Department responded quickly after receiving the 911 call at 6:43 p.m. Fire Capt. Rob Jacyna said a hot-water line broke. |
